Verses about Women

The Bible has encouraging and insightful truths about women. Christian women can find inspiration in Scripture for how to be faithful in thought, word, and action. The Bible provides helpful guidance on their identity and how women can honor God with their lives and hearts.

“The LORD God said, ‘It is not good for the man to be alone. I will make a helper suitable for him’” (Genesis 2:18).

“A gracious woman attains honor” (Proverbs 11:6).

“The wise woman builds her house, but with her own hands the foolish one tears hers down” (Proverbs 14:1).

“She speaks with wisdom, and faithful instruction is on her tongue. She watches over the affairs of her household and does not eat the bread of idleness” (Proverbs 31:26-27).

Verses for Wisdom

The world says that wisdom is found in having a high IQ or believing what the majority thinks is right. However, the Bible makes it clear that wisdom is from God alone. Gaining God’s wisdom is worth it. Women can stand firm on God’s word and know that they are getting real wisdom and truth that will shape how they act, live, think, and speak.

“Do not forsake wisdom, and she will protect you; love her, and she will watch over you. The beginning of wisdom is this: Get wisdom. Though it cost all you have, get understanding” (Proverbs 4:6-7).

“Be wise in the way you act toward outsiders; make the most of every opportunity. Let your conversation be always full of grace, seasoned with salt, so that you may know how to answer everyone” (Colossians 4:5-6).

“If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God, who gives generously to all without finding fault, and it will be given to you” (James 1:5).

“But the wisdom that comes from heaven is first of all pure; then peace-loving, considerate, submissive, full of mercy and good fruit, impartial and sincere” (James 3:17).

Verses to Overcome Anxiety

Anxiety threatens to hold women captive and keep them from having the precious peace of Jesus. In the Bible, there are verses that provide instruction for overcoming anxiety and leaning into the peace of God. Women do not have to carry their burdens, but can come to God for consolation, peace, and to lay everything at His feet.

“Cast your cares on the LORD and he will sustain you; he will never let the righteous be shaken” (Psalm 55:22).

“When my anxious thoughts multiply within me, Your consolations delight my soul” (Psalm 94:19).

“Come to me, all you who are weary and burdened, and I will give you rest. Take my yoke upon you and learn from me, for I am gentle and humble in heart, and you will find rest for your souls. For my yoke is easy and my burden is light” (Matthew 11:28-30).

“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you. I do not give to you as the world gives. Do not let your hearts be troubled and do not be afraid” (John 14:27).

Verses for Encouragement

Whether someone is feeling overwhelmed, worried, or uncertain, Scripture is a place women can come for encouragement. Through God’s truth, real encouragement is found. God is loving, good, and faithful – this is the amazing character of God that the Bible teaches. By finding encouragement in God’s word, women can cast out fear, loneliness, and doubt, and have the strength they need in Christ.

“Know therefore that the Lord your God is God; he is the faithful God, keeping his covenant of love to a thousand generations of those who love him and keep his commandments” (Deuteronomy 7:9).

“But they who wait for the Lord shall renew their strength; they shall mount up with wings like eagles; they shall run and not be weary; they shall walk and not faint” (Isaiah 40:31).

“Surely your goodness and love will follow me all the days of my life, and I will dwell in the house of the Lord forever” (Psalm 23:6).

“But the Lord is faithful, and he will strengthen you and protect you from the evil one” (1 Thessalonians 3:3).

Verses for Forgiveness

Like many believers, Christian women may struggle to feel and believe that they are truly forgiven. The enemy may try to keep women down through shame and regret. Sometimes, women may feel that their sins are just too big for God to actually forgive. Scripture teaches that when we confess our sins, God will forgive! Jesus went to the cross and paid the debt for humanity. Scripture teaches to walk in the ways of forgiveness because we are forgiven.

“Then I acknowledged my sin to you and did not cover up my iniquity. I said, ‘I will confess my transgressions to the Lord.’ And you forgave the guilt of my sin” (Psalm 32:5).

“The Lord our God is merciful and forgiving, even though we have rebelled against him” (Daniel 9:9).

“Bear with each other and forgive one another if any of you has a grievance against someone. Forgive as the Lord forgave you” (Colossians 3:13).

“If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just and will forgive us our sins and purify us from all unrighteousness” (1 John 1:9).

Verses for Hope

When life gets tough, when a woman goes through a tough season, or when her life takes an unexpected turn, it can be hard to keep hope. Scripture teaches that God is a God of hope! Women can pray for hope – God will hear their prayers and fill them to overflowing with hope. Women can put their hope fully in God, knowing they can depend on Him and that they have been brought into His kingdom.

“But as for me, I watch in hope for the Lord, I wait for God my Savior; my God will hear me” (Micah 7:7).

“May the God of hope fill you with all joy and peace as you trust in him, so that you may overflow with hope by the power of the Holy Spirit” (Romans 15:13).

“I pray that the eyes of your heart may be enlightened in order that you may know the hope to which he has called you, the riches of his glorious inheritance in his holy people” (Ephesians 1:18).

“For he has rescued us from the dominion of darkness and brought us into the kingdom of the Son he loves” (Colossians 1:13).

Verses for Grace

Women sometimes struggle with accepting God’s grace. At times, they expect too much of themselves and try to achieve perfection, which leaves little room for understanding. Scripture teaches that God is gracious. God wants woman to approach His throne of grace and He will give them grace in times of need. God’s grace will give women the strength they need.

“The Lord is compassionate and gracious, slow to anger, abounding in love” (Psalm 103:8).

“Let us then approach God’s throne of grace with confidence, so that we may receive mercy and find grace to help us in our time of need” (Hebrews 4:16).

“Be strong in the grace that is in Christ Jesus” (2 Timothy 2:1).

“All of you, clothe yourselves with humility toward one another, because God opposes the proud, but gives grace to the humble” (1 Peter 5:5).

Verses for Purpose

Women may feel like they do not have a purpose when they get caught up in their day-to-day life and responsibilities. It is easy to feel directionless when a woman is in a job she does not like, is waiting for clarity from God, or living out the various tasks of motherhood or caretaking. The Bible teaches that all believers have gifts to use, have plans and purposes from God, and can meaningfully serve God in any and every season of life. Even if she can’t see it at the time, God has hopeful plans for her.

“There is a time for everything, and a season for every activity under the heavens” (Ecclesiastes 3:1).

“So, whether you eat or drink, or whatever you do, do all to the glory of God” (1 Corinthians 10:31).

“For we are God’s handiwork, created in Christ Jesus to do good works, which God prepared in advance for us to do” (Ephesians 2:10).

“Each of you should use whatever gift you have received to serve others, as faithful stewards of God’s grace in its various forms” (Ephesians 4:10).
